Three Flautas

ratingratingratingratingrating  (0)
$11.50
3 Rolled taquitos filled with chicken or beef, topped with salsa, guac, sour cream, and lettuce.
Hotness ranking:
spicyspicyspicyspicy
Share:
map
$$
1415 North 4th Street, San Jose, CA 95112
4089823121
ratingratingratingratingrating
Open

Add Your Review